1. Maintenance methods1. Temperature: It can withstand high temperatures and is slightly cold-resistant. The temperature suitable for its development is between 15 and 30 degrees. If the temperature is below 5 degrees, it will be frostbite. Warm measures need to be taken in winter, and some shade should be provided in summer to prevent burns on branches and leaves. 2. Watering: Water once every two days during the growing period and once every three days during the flowering period. Sufficient water is conducive to flowering. When caring for it outdoors, good drainage is needed during the rainy season to prevent the roots from being soaked in water for a long time, which would cause root rot. 3. Fertilization: During the growing season, fertilizer needs to be applied once a month. The temperature is relatively high in summer, so you need to choose fertilizers with mild effects to avoid fertilizer damage. After it blooms, you can add one or two application of quick-acting fertilizer. 4. Light: It likes sunshine, so sufficient sunlight stimulation must be ensured during the breeding process. Generally, the daily light exposure should not be less than 7 hours. The sunlight is relatively strong in summer, so appropriate shade can be provided. Normal light should be provided at other times. If you want to maintain it indoors, you should put it in a place with sufficient light. Keeping it in a dark place will affect its growth, the branches and leaves will turn yellow, and the color of the flowers will fade. 2. Breeding techniques1. Reproduction: Silk flower is generally propagated by cuttings in early spring or the rainy season. Insert healthy branches into the sand, water them thoroughly, and place them in a cool place for maintenance. They will grow roots in about 20 days. It should be noted that watering should not be excessive to avoid water accumulation in the soil. Because the cuts of the branches are easily infected by bacteria, so do not water too much. 2. Pruning: If you want to grow it well, pruning is an essential step. Whether it is dead branches and leaves or extra flower buds, they all need to be cut off. One is to concentrate nutrients, and the other is to make it more beautiful. Proper pruning is not only beneficial to its growth, but also plays a certain role in the prevention and control of pests and diseases. 3. Problem Diagnosis1. Pests: The beetle is its natural enemy. The beetle particularly likes to gnaw on the stems, branches and leaves of the plant, which will seriously affect the flowering quality of the plant and its health. If you find beetles on the plant, you can use insecticide to spray it. Before spraying, the insecticide needs to be diluted. 2. Pathology: Leaf rust is a relatively common disease, which is characterized by large-scale shedding of branches and leaves, reducing the ornamental value of the plant. If the above situation is found, you can use triadimefon solution for spraying treatment. IV. Other issues1. Edibility: Its fruit is edible. 2. Can it be grown indoors? It is non-toxic and its flowers have a fragrant smell that can eliminate room odors, so it can be grown indoors. |
